Output ff426240733cc3748acc3910ffed006105f9ebe1f682056a4cb7dfd1554bed40:1

value
16522856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3701fbebdcbd5a1acf1ff4b18bbbc31447b2fd24 OP_EQUAL
address
36hsTx3cW47Fj81QHz69KTeoyDWtwLhJnh
transaction
ff426240733cc3748acc3910ffed006105f9ebe1f682056a4cb7dfd1554bed40
confirmations
529559
spent
true